-
CVS 最早期的版本控制軟件,是把文件集中保存到中心服務器 SVN 是在CVS的基礎上的加強版,可以還原到某個時間段 git 是分布式的版本控制軟件 github 是基于網站托管的查看全部
-
git status git add min.cpp git commit //add your comment,in fact, this means you have only commited your code to your local sever, but not remote server....... git push查看全部
-
利用工具提升工作效率,而不是去學習工具本身 1、多用客戶端和工具,少用命令行,除非在linux服務器上直接開發 2、每次提交前,diff自己的代碼,以免提交錯誤的代碼 3、下班回家前,整理好自己的工作區 4、并行的項目,使用分支開發 5、遇到沖突時,搞明白沖突的原因,千萬不要隨意丟棄別人的代碼 6、產品發布后,記得打tag,方便將來拉分支修bug查看全部
-
另一種分支方式,更適合開源軟件 修改提交發布新分支 右鍵點擊項目名稱,view in github,點擊按鈕merge push request,commit查看全部
-
里程碑 = 穩定版本號. 里程碑的含義是: 一個階段比較穩定的版本,正式提交發布出去.提供zip下載. 操作步驟: 1. 在github網站上.進入項目首頁. 2. 橫欄按鈕(commits, branches, release等),找到release按鈕. 3. 找到按鈕:draft a new release,點擊進入下一頁面. 4. 填入版本號,以及說明信息. 5. 完成后,點擊publish release,將軟件發布出去. 6. 這樣就完成里程碑建立,同時會自動生成zip下載鏈接.查看全部
-
git log 復制commit id git reset --hard commitID git reflog git reset --hard commitID查看全部
-
git log 復制commit id git reset --hard commitID git reflog\查看全部
-
在gitHub官網下載gitHub客戶端查看全部
-
CVS-SVN-GIT-GITHUB查看全部
-
版本管理工具的發展歷史查看全部
-
clone--add--commit--push查看全部
-
版本管理工具的作用: 備份文件 記錄歷史 回到過去 多端共享查看全部
-
分布式版本管理工具 集中式:中心服務器,需要聯網(cvs svn) 分布式:擁有版本庫即可(git) github是一個網站托管,是基于git 極客主流查看全部
-
1. 命令: git log // 顯示所有提交記錄.可以查看所有提交的id 2. 在所有提交記錄中,選擇需要回退到的commit ID(一個長字符串),復制. 3. 命令: git reset --hard XXYYZCCRERR // 最后一串是commit ID.完成回滾操作.hard是當前環境的一個指針 4. 命令: git log // 顯示新的提交記錄. 回到過去容易,怎么帶著過去的代碼回到未來? 為什么git log 顯示的是長id 而個itreflog顯示的卻是短id查看全部
-
linux 下用軟件包管理器安裝Git,有中文版 $yum install git查看全部
舉報
0/150
提交
取消